Play on: Facebook finally launches ‘official’ music videos – The Industry Observer

Facebook has finally pressed the button on music videos.
Over the weekend, the social giant rolled out shareable, licensed music videos for its users in the U.S. with global music video premieres pegged for the coming weeks, according to a blog post.
Its the first shot fired in a battle royale with YouTube which for well over a decade has sat on its throne as the King of music video content.
